I adding geo-referencing to the Billygoat RouteGadget this morning.

So, if you have your GPS tracks from the event, you should be able to import them into RG a bit easier, with maybe a little fiddling on your part.

If you have uploaded your tracks to AP, then click on your earth symbol, and then download the tracks in GPX format. Upload to RG by opening the BG event, selecting GPS in the upper right hand corner, pick the format (GPX), and browse to the saved file.

Hit OK, and then select Choose Class/Course (Billygoat), then Choose Your Name (in the upper list of names, not the lower list of names).

Reminder that people who have imported GPS tracks will show up in the bottom of the list of results as * GPS Mouse, Mickey.
